What you’ll do

As the first line of technical support, you’ll troubleshoot and resolve issues across end-user hardware, software, and connectivity. You will handle requests submitted by phone, email, and in person, and you’ll support staff through desk-side visits and remote connections.

  • Troubleshoot and resolve problems with computer hardware, peripheral hardware (printers, copiers, faxes, scanners, etc.), software, and internet and network services
  • Support email, phones and phone service, and network and internet equipment
  • Set up and support A/V equipment for meetings, training, and events
  • Document requests and issues in the department tracking system, including assigning, updating, and completing work orders
  • Prepare, configure, and deploy new, replacement, and upgraded computer hardware, peripherals, software, phones, network equipment, and cables
  • Create and maintain user accounts, shared resources, and permissions using Active Directory and support internal systems
  • Assist with maintenance and application of information security practices, with a focus on end-user hardware, software, and processes
  • Coordinate with external vendors for installations and repairs when assigned
  • Perform other duties as assigned
